Chapter 3 Just a dream

In Lin Yunyan's memory, Xu Jian had a long, terrible scar on her right leg.

That was cut down by Xiliang's saber. It was Xu Jian's military exploits, and it also cut off Xu Jian's way of continuing to join the army.

 At the time of the injury, Xu Jian was only sixteen years old, which should have been the age when a good man's sword would be unsheathed.

He and his comrades killed hundreds of Xiliang soldiers. When they returned to the camp, the military doctor was helpless about his **** right leg.

 The leg was saved, but it was also damaged.

 Since then, in Xu Jian's words, this leg has become a “decoration”.

It's a long time to put on a show, so as not to leave the trousers empty, and to say that it has no use, it's really useless.

 Have to be taken care of, making medicines, injecting needles, pressing, beating every day...

Even so, it is still shrinking month by month, losing vitality, and with the snake-like scar, it looks more and more scary.

The left leg was somehow involved. I could still stand on one leg and walk for a while with the help of a cane. Later, the cane became unusable and it was completely tied to the wheelchair.

Lin Yunyan set her sights on Concubine Wen again.

The concubine carefully talked to the empress dowager about how she saw the clue that day.

The more Lin Yunyan listened, the more confused she became. She had seen Xu Jian's leg with her own eyes and saw the scar. It was obviously such a serious injury. Why could Xu Jian still walk like a normal person now?

Could it be that after encountering Hua Tuo and Bian Que, the master has rejuvenated his life?

Hearing the regret in the concubine's words, Lin Yunyan was filled with joy.

 Compared to being in a wheelchair and never being able to stand up again, just a slight lameness doesn't mean you're fine?

Of course, she still has doubts.

Downcasting her eyes, Lin Yunyan pretended to sigh: "How could the Duke of Guo be hurt so badly?"

"Yes," Princess Wen sighed, "that skill could have been like that of his grandfather, but... speaking of it, that injury is also..."

Lin Yunyan listened carefully and heard that the concubine suddenly paused. When she spoke again, she only sighed: "It's a pity, it's a pity."

Such a twist was not considered blunt, but Lin Yunyan could hear it.

Concubine Wen must have thought of something and swallowed the "reason why Xu Jian was injured" that was on her lips. Even at that moment, her eyes moved slightly towards the Empress Dowager and then looked back.

why?

 Lin Yunyan was puzzled.

 Xu Jian was injured because of attacking the Xiliang people. It was a military achievement and it was fair and honorable. What can't be mentioned?

“I was just talking and forgot to deal with the cards,” Mrs. Wen put her hands on the horse and said, “Come on, come on, I want to win back the city.”

 The card table became lively again.

 The coral was placed on the shelf, and the cicadas were chirping outside. Cards were touched and played on the table, and some playful words were said from time to time. No one mentioned the person who gave the coral.

 After playing three rounds, Wen Taifei looked tired, and then the game ended.

 Wen Taifei stood up and left.

Lin Yunyan sent him out and left the main hall. She wanted to ask Xu Jian about it again, but after thinking about it for a while, she gave up.

 Concubine Wen liked to talk about family matters, but she also knew the appropriateness of the topic. She was also very obedient to the Empress Dowager. Since she had swallowed her words back before, she would not say anything no matter how she asked.

Sent all the way outside Cining Palace, Lin Yunyan turned around and returned to the side hall.

The card table has been put away, and the Empress Dowager moved to sit on the Arhat bed by the window, leaning on the bed and looking at one place.

Lin Yunyan looked along and saw the pot of coral given by Xu Jian.

Did the empress happen to be looking there, or was she thinking about Xu Jian?

Lin Yunyan was not sure for a while.

Sensing her return, the Empress Dowager withdrew her gaze and waved to her: "Come and sit here at Ai's house for a while."

Lin Yunyan agreed and sat down on the other side of the bed.

"Are you worried?" the Queen Mother asked, and without waiting for Lin Yunyan to reply, she added, "No need to deny it, the Ai family can see that you are more tense today than usual."

Being exposed in this way, Lin Yunyan was of course unable to speak out.   She was really nervous.

 One moment there was a huge fire, and the next moment she was in Cining Palace. For her, it was the Cining Palace a few years ago. It was so earth-shaking that even if she had guessed her situation, she could not immediately deal with it calmly.

 Xu Jian's leg injury was different from what she remembered, so how much had other people and things changed?

 A single hair move affects the whole body.

 She needs some time to calm down and think about it carefully and figure out the current situation.

 Xu Jian said before that there are prerequisites for the mind to be calm and calm.

 Only when everything is under control can one truly be calm, relaxed and strategizing.

 Otherwise, pretending to be fake and deceiving unfamiliar people may still be effective, but in the eyes of discerning people, it is just a paper tiger.

And the Empress Dowager, who has seen countless people, is also very familiar with Lin Yunyan.

The situation at this moment obviously did not give her time to slowly collect her thoughts, and Gu Li's method would only be counterproductive to the Empress Dowager. Lin Yunyan lowered her eyes, and after the silence of "he hesitated to speak", she finally He spoke in a low voice: "When I was resting in the side hall, I had a nightmare."

When the Queen Mother heard this, she laughed: "You are not a five or six-year-old child. Why is your dream so scary?"

"The fire," Lin Yunyan said, "the house is on fire, the smoke is billowing, I am trapped inside, I can't escape at all..."

With just a few words, the Empress Dowager's eyebrows suddenly twisted, and the smile disappeared from the corner of her mouth.

She reached out and hugged Lin Yunyan into her arms, supporting her back: "Good boy, it's just a dream, it's just a dream."

 When Grandma Wang saw this, she quickly winked at the others.

The maids and chambermaids filed out quietly. Grandma Wang glanced at the two people again, then withdrew, stood outside the curtain, clasped her hands and recited "Amitabha" secretly.

 She also saw that the princess was absent-minded at the card table.

  It wasn't that the princess showed all her emotions on her face, but the empress dowager looked at the princess several times.

Grandma Wang has been serving the Empress Dowager personally for many years. Of course, she will never miss a look or a look in her eyes. It is this thoughtfulness and caution that allows her to pick up clues from the Empress Dowager.

Yuan thought that maybe something unpleasant happened to the girl's family, but she didn't expect it to be such a nightmare.

It's no wonder that the princess was absent-minded, no wonder that the Queen Mother hesitated to speak when asked about it, and no wonder that the Queen Mother felt so heartbroken after hearing this.

That year, the late emperor was seriously ill, and the emperor, who was still a prince, took the prince's concubine, the young highness, and several ministers and ministers to the temple to pray for blessings. Late at night, there were flames blazing down the mountain, and there were screams for help. The Holy Spirit insisted on leading the guards to rescue. Unexpectedly, a fire also broke out in the temple, and the princess, the young highness, and the princess' mother were trapped in the temple. After rescuing the young highness, she went to save the princess again...

 When the bad news came, Grandma Wang remembered it very clearly, and the empress was heartbroken.

To the empress, she was more than just a niece from her mother's family. She had been serving the empress in the palace since she was eight years old, and later became a reading companion for the princess. She was no different from her own daughter.

 After that, the murderous conspiracy under the mountain was torn apart, and the government and the public were in shock. It was not until the Holy Emperor ascended the throne that things gradually stabilized.

The fire on the mountain was an accident, and it was just the people trapped in the fire, because the Holy One took away the guards and monks and was unable to rescue them, but they could never come back.

 The prince's concubine, the princess's mother…

 The total number of people killed was nine.

The princess was not involved in that disaster. Xu was close to her mother and daughter. When she was a child, she had several dreams of fires when she lived in Cining Palace. She cried incessantly in the middle of the night and was hugged by the Empress Dowager to coax her to sleep. I asked about the residence of the uncle, and he said that he would have nightmares two or three times in a month.

 Fortunately, as I grow older, my nightmares have become less frequent, especially in recent years, and I have never had any nightmares in return for the princess.

The Empress Dowager is still the same as before. She can't hear words like "fire" and "flood", and she feels uncomfortable for a long time after hearing them.

Thinking of this, Grandma Wang quietly took a look inside.

The way the Queen Mother comforted the princess was still the same as before.
